Key Features
- 550MHz bandwidth: Tested to 550MHz, the cable provides headroom beyond Cat5e for cleaner transmission and better support of high-speed 1Gb networks and shorter 10Gb runs.
- Solid bare copper conductor: Made with solid bare copper, not CCA, for reliable signal integrity and compliance with TIA/EIA 568-C.2 requirements.
- Supports PoE and VoIP: The conductor quality and Cat6 spec make it suitable for Power over Ethernet and VoIP devices without unexpected voltage drops.
- CMR riser rated jacket: Flame-retardant riser jacket allows safe indoor installation in vertical riser spaces between floors.
- Pull box convenience: The 1000ft pull box with sequential foot markings simplifies long runs and helps track remaining cable during installation.
- ETL listed and RoHS compliant: Independently tested and certified, offering assurance on safety and materials compliance for professional installs.
Who It's For
This cable is best for network installers, small business IT teams, and homeowners doing whole-house rewiring who need a long, single-reel solution that meets industry standards. Its solid bare copper conductors and riser-rated jacket make it appropriate where durability and code compliance matter.
It is not aimed at people who need outdoor, direct-burial, or shielded cable for high-EMI environments; those users should look for shielded or outdoor-rated variants. Also, if you only need short patch leads or pre-terminated cables, bulk cable in a pull box may be overkill.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is this cable suitable for 10Gb Ethernet?
It supports 10Gb at shorter distances and is primarily optimized for 1Gb networks with headroom provided by the 550MHz rating.
Can this cable be used outdoors?
No, the cable is intended for indoor use with a CMR riser-rated jacket and is not rated for outdoor or direct burial installations.
Does it support Power over Ethernet?
Yes, the solid bare copper conductor and Cat6 specification support PoE and VoIP applications.
